| /*****************************************************************************/
 | |
| /* The following string definitions are used for documentation strings.      */
 | |
| /* In Python these will be written to the console when doing a               */
 | |
| /* Blender.Window.__doc__                                                    */
 | |
| /*****************************************************************************/
 | |
| char M_Window_doc[] =
 | |
| "The Blender Window module\n\n";
 | |
| 
 | |
| char M_Window_Redraw_doc[] =
 | |
| "() - Force a redraw of a specific Window Type (see Window.Types)";
 | |
| 
 | |
| char M_Window_RedrawAll_doc[] =
 | |
| "() - Redraw all windows";
 | |
| 
 | |
| char M_Window_QRedrawAll_doc[] =
 | |
| "() - Redraw all windows by queue event";
 | |
| 
 | |
| char M_Window_FileSelector_doc[] =
 | |
| "(callback [, title]) - Open a file selector window.\n\
 | |
| The selected filename is used as argument to a function callback f(name)\n\
 | |
| that you must provide. 'title' is optional and defaults to 'SELECT FILE'.\n\n\
 | |
| Example:\n\n\
 | |
| import Blender\n\n\
 | |
| def my_function(filename):\n\
 | |
|   print 'The selected file was: ', filename\n\n\
 | |
| Blender.Window.FileSelector(my_function, 'SAVE FILE')\n";
 | |
| 
 | |
| char M_Window_ImageSelector_doc[] =
 | |
| "(callback [, title]) - Open an image selector window.\n\
 | |
| The selected filename is used as argument to a function callback f(name)\n\
 | |
| that you must provide. 'title' is optional and defaults to 'SELECT IMAGE'.\n\n\
 | |
| Example:\n\n\
 | |
| import Blender\n\n\
 | |
| def my_function(filename):\n\
 | |
|   print 'The selected image file was: ', filename\n\n\
 | |
| Blender.Window.ImageSelector(my_function, 'LOAD IMAGE')\n";
 | |
| 
 | |
| char M_Window_DrawProgressBar_doc[] =
 | |
| "(done, text) - Draw a progress bar.\n\
 | |
| 'done' is a float value <= 1.0, 'text' contains info about what is\n\
 | |
| currently being done.";
 | |
| 
 | |
| char M_Window_GetCursorPos_doc[] =
 | |
| "() - Get the current 3d cursor position as a list of three floats.";
 | |
| 
 | |
| char M_Window_SetCursorPos_doc[] =
 | |
| "([f,f,f]) - Set the current 3d cursor position from a list of three floats.";
 | |
| 
 | |
| char M_Window_GetViewVector_doc[] =
 | |
| "() - Get the current 3d view vector as a list of three floats [x,y,z].";
 | |
| 
 | |
| char M_Window_GetViewMatrix_doc[] =
 | |
| "() - Get the current 3d view matrix.";
